Spatiotemporal modeling of electric vehicle charging demand for strategic EV charger deployment in Metro Manila
The Philippines is currently facing debilitating issues regarding extreme traffic conditions and excessive greenhouse gas emissions, both of which are mainly caused by its outdated transportation sector. As a result, the country is currently enacting laws and programs that involve the modernization...
